RFID Module 13.56 MHz Card Reader MFRC522 Reader/Writer
The RFID module 13.56 MHz MFRC522 Reader Writer is a compact and versatile solution. It supports Mifare Classic and NTAG213/215/216 tags. This module is perfect for makers and engineers. Use it with Arduino, Raspberry Pi, or ESP32.
This module uses SPI and I2C interfaces. It reads tags from 3 to 5 cm away. You can extend the range with a larger antenna. The onboard antenna makes integration easy. Libraries for Arduino and Python are available.

Key Features
- 13.56 MHz RFID/NFC Support – Works with Mifare Classic S50/S70, NTAG213/215/216, and ISO14443-A/B cards.
- SPI & I2C Interface – Flexible connectivity for Arduino, Raspberry Pi, ESP8266, and ESP32.
- Short-Range Reading – 3–5 cm range, extendable with a larger antenna.
- Onboard Antenna – Compact design for easy integration into projects.
- Library Support – Works with Arduino MFRC522 library and Python for Raspberry Pi.
- Read and Write Capability – Store and retrieve data on compatible tags.
